In WesternAnimation, {{Anime}}, and {{Comics}} it is common to sum up behavioral problems or character flaws as being the direct result of some greatly underdeveloped organ in a character's body. Maybe said character [[Literature/HowTheGrinchStoleChristmas has a heart that is too small]] and thus cannot properly love or maybe their brain resembles the size of a golf ball and thus lacks normal intelligence. Of course, having an organ this small in RealLife would [[YouFailBiologyForever cause serious complications for most of these characters]], so this trope is very often PlayedForLaughs.

* The Koala has a brain like this. Its brain used to fill the whole cranial cavity, but when it adapted to a diet of eucalyptus leaves (which are very low in nutrients), its brain shrank. It now resembles two shriveled walnut halves on top of the brain stem.
